#395633 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#395633 is composed of 22.4% red, 33.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 109.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.5% and a lightness of 26.9%. #395633 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ac66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#395633 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#395633 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#395633 has RGB values of R:57, G:86,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 3757619.

Shades and Tints of #395633
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c07 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#395633
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434643 is the less saturated color, while #1a8504 is the most saturated one.
